How are students notified when an act of violence occurs?
Many methods are used, and more are always being evaluated and considered: e-mail, notices on K-State’s web site, K-State Alerts, and notices to radio and television news media. K-State Alerts text and voice messaging to cell phones is available here . In case of emergency, K-State will set up a central communication point with a dedicated phone number.
